Cleaning Instructions

Disinfectants utilized in agricultural animal
confinement buildings may contain chemicals
damaging to components of the heater.
Protect the safety gas control valve by wrapping with a
plastic bag before disinfecting.
Always make sure to remove the plastic bag or other
protective covering before start up.
Clean the heater betweeen turns to maintain proper
combustion and to eliminate future problems.
Problems associated with lack of cleaning typically are:
Black soot on inside of canopy.
Gas backflashing in venturi tube or injector body.
Burner flame appearing beyond outer cone.
Ensure gas is shut off and filter is removed prior to cleaning
process. When cleaning is completed, install filter, ensure
heater is at proper hanging position,and all gas connections
to the heater are securely tightened. Open fuel supply
valves and light the heaters.
A. HEATER
C C L L E E A A N N I I N N G G W W I I T T H H P P R R E E S S S S U U R R I I Z Z E E D D A A I I R R
1. Direct air against combustion cones to blow out
buildup of dust in cones and venturi tube. Reverse
the process and blow air into the air intake opening
and out through combustion cones. See Fig.8.
2. Repeat until dust no longer comes from heater.
3. Inspect the heater to ensure reasonable cleanliness.

C C L L E E A A N N I I N N G G W W I I T T H H W W A A T T E E R R
Clean the heater with water using standard faucet pressure.
DO N N OT U U SE H H IGH P P RESSURE W W ASHERS!
1. Wrap the safety control valve with a plastic bag to
protect this part from water.
2. Spray water against the cones to wash out the build
up of dust in the cones and the venturi tube. Work
your way around the entire cone assembly. Reverse
the process and run water through the air intake and
out through combustion cones. See Fig. 9.

3. Repeat until water runs clean.
4. Remove bag. Inspect heater to ensure it is
reasonably clean.
5. Light the heater to dry it.
B. FILTER
Refer to the following for filter cleaning instructions.
A. Between building turns:
-- Remove filter and shake it.
-- Use compressed air or standard faucet pressure to
clean it.
-- Do not use high pressure water, air, or a
washingmachine. Filter material damage may
occur.
-- If water is used, squeeze out excess water from
filter before installation.
-- Let filter dry before lighting heater.
B. During turn while heater is in use:
-- Remove filter and shake off dust.
-- Do not squeeze or tap filter while filter is installed
on heater. Doing so will cause dust to be blown into
venturi tube or combustion cones.
